Key Ingredients for Baked Brie With Red Pepper Jelly

  • 1 whole Brie cheese (8 ounces)
  • ½ cup red pepper jelly (feel free to use homemade for an extra touch!)
  • ¼ cup chopped pecans or walnuts (optional)
  • 1 garlic clove, minced (optional)
  • Fresh herbs for garnish (optional)
  • Crackers or sliced baguette for serving

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Preheat Your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Prepare the Cheese: Place the whole Brie on a parchment-lined baking sheet. If you’d like, you can slice the top rind to allow the jelly to seep in better, but it’s not necessary.
  3. Add the Toppings: Spoon the red pepper jelly over the top of the Brie. If you’re feeling adventurous, sprinkle minced garlic and chopped pecans or walnuts for an added crunch and depth of flavor.
  4. Bake It: Place the cheese in the oven and bake for about 10-15 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and warmed through but not overflowing.
  5. Final Touch: Once baked, carefully remove it from the oven, let it cool for a few minutes, then garnish with fresh herbs if desired.
  6. Serve: Pair it with your favorite crackers or toasted baguette slices, and voila! You’ve got a stunning appetizer!

Top Tips for Perfecting Baked Brie With Red Pepper Jelly

  • Cheese Selection: Opt for a high-quality Brie for the best results—its creaminess will shine through!
  • Possible Substitutions: If you’re avoiding nuts, feel free to skip them, or substitute with sunflower seeds for that extra crunch.
  • Avoid Overbaking: Keep an eye on your Brie as it bakes; you want it soft and melty, not overflowing.
  • Flavor Profiles: Experiment with different jellies like apricot or cranberry to switch things up based on your mood or season.

Storing and Reheating Tips

If you happen to have leftovers (though I doubt it with how delicious this is), let the Baked Brie cool completely before covering it with plastic wrap. You can store it in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. If you’re looking to reheat, simply place it back in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es, or until warmed through. This will help maintain that delightful creamy texture!
